Project Overview: Expo 2030 Riyadh

Expo 2030 Riyadh is a global platform focused on sustainable development, innovation, and transformative thinking, under the theme “Foresight for Tomorrow.” Scheduled from October 2030 to March 2031, the event anticipates over 40 million visits. The 6 km2 Masterplan provides a framework for participation and infrastructure, with an exhibition space of 491,100 m2 GFA accommodating up to 197 countries and 29 international organizations. Bechtel will manage the infrastructure program for Expo 2030 Riyadh Company (ERC), encompassing early works, utilities, and public spaces. The project’s master plan adheres to international sustainability standards for urban afforestation, treated water, and energy sources, with the site transitioning into a mixed-use legacy development post-event.

Key Responsibilities

  • Conduct and document daily inspections to ensure each project site is visited at least once per shift, verifying the implementation of health and safety requirements by the Client contractor, subcontractors, suppliers, and vendors.
  • Raise observations from site visits through the Employer's online reporting systems for health and safety.
  • Participate in health and safety pre-start kick-off meetings with Client contractors, adhering to the Expo Riyadh Construction Safety Manual.
  • Perform daily verification of the suitability and ongoing availability of security, traffic management, logistics, and emergency arrangements, including these in the daily inspection report.
  • Conduct daily follow-ups on safety non-conformances to ensure timely rectification or escalation, and that appropriate controls are maintained.
  • Issue a suspension of work instruction under the contract in cases of lacking safety control, imminent risk of injury, or continuous failure to address unsafe acts/conditions, ensuring notification to the ESH Manager who will then inform ERC.
  • Discuss the development and implementation of reward and recognition schemes in Client contractors' weekly meetings.
  • Conduct daily verification of compliance with approved Traffic Management Plans and PAPI programs.
  • Conduct monthly discussions with Client contractors to ensure they produce a health and safety file as per the Employer’s requirements.
